How much does it cost to rent an apartment in West Hills?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| West Hills Studio Apartments | $1,873 | $1,245 | $3,822 |
| West Hills 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,369 | $1,550 | $4,553 |
| West Hills 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,096 | $1,895 | $6,238 |
| West Hills 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,604 | $2,929 | $5,587 |
